Laboratory Medicine: A Comprehensive Guide to Test Selection and Interpretation
Laboratory medicine, an indispensable discipline in healthcare, plays a pivotal role in medical diagnosis and patient management. This comprehensive guide, tailored specifically for medical students, residents, and practitioners, provides a thorough understanding of laboratory test selection and result interpretation. By harnessing the knowledge within these pages, healthcare professionals can optimize patient outcomes and streamline the diagnostic process.
An Intuitive and Accessible Approach
To enhance readability and comprehension, the guide adopts a consistent structure for each disease topic. The chapters commence with a concise overview of the disorder, followed by an in-depth discussion supported by comprehensive tables. These tables meticulously detail the specific laboratory tests used for evaluating each disorder, along with their diagnostic significance. Moreover, they provide valuable insights into baseline tests that can rule out diagnostic possibilities, as well as clinical indications that necessitate further screening and specialized testing.
Cutting-Edge Knowledge and Advanced Techniques
Staying abreast of the latest advancements in laboratory medicine, the guide incorporates the most up-to-date information and techniques. Forty-six laboratory methods are lucidly illustrated, presenting details on their cost implications and complexity. To facilitate understanding, over 200 tables and full-color algorithms encapsulate vital information. Additionally, vibrant blood-smear micrographs vividly showcase common abnormal morphologies of red blood cells.

Vital Reference for Clinical Practice
The guide features an extensive table of Clinical Laboratory Reference Values, enabling healthcare professionals to seamlessly convert values between US and SI units. Furthermore, it includes a comprehensive overview of genetic test options that have become commonplace in contemporary clinical practice.
